About Gisselle Vila Benites
I study the relationship between communities and natural resources policies, examining the equity and sustainability of resource governance in ecologically sensitive areas. My current research aims to strengthen indigenous governance over post-mining environmental remediation in the Amazon. More information: https://cals.cornell.edu/gisselle-vila-benites

Gisselle Vila Benites work experience
A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.
Cornell Atkinson Postdoctoral Fellow
CurrentMy post-doctoral project examines the environmental remediation of abandoned mining ponds in the Peruvian Amazon. Working in collaboration with Indigenous communities and partner NGO Instituto del Bien Común, our task is to design an environmental monitoring framework that expands indigenous governance in remediation plans.
Honorary Fellow | Center For Mining And Sustainability Studies (Cems)
My research covers the governance of artisanal and small-scale gold mining in Peru, approaching two dimensions: a) the ebb and flow of formalization policy; b) the reorganization of the gold value chain before traceability concerns. Working with multi-sited ethnography in the Amazon, the Andes, and overseas markets, cross-cutting findings highlight rarely identified actors in chain and formalization governance, such as gold traders, processing plants, and international development organizations.
Project Director
l led the learning and collaboration strategies of the National Program for the Sound Management of Chemical Substances. My goals included developing a national research agenda on persistent organic pollutants, including mercury and pesticides.
Ph.D. Candidate In Geography
My dissertation contrasts pathways to mining formalization in Peru and Colombia. I introduce a framework attuned to the temporal dimensions of formalization and the various collectives who struggle to shape this policy. I performed a "patchy" ethnography, covering various arenas over 14 months, ranging from ethnic communities to mining conventions.

Coordinator | Advanced Studies In Sustainable Development And Social Inequalities (Trandes)
TRANDES is a scholarship and advanced studies program led by PUCP (Peru) and Freie Universitat Berlin (Germany), and funded by the German Federal Ministry of Economic Cooperation and Development. I have collaborated with the identification of priority areas and formulation of selection criteria, supporting young researchers coming from and focusing on the Andean Region. My roles included supervising funding allocation, periodical reporting to the funding agency, and coordinating the academic organization of the program.

Program Manager - Master In Water Management
I co-led the scoping study to position a unique graduate program on critical water management, bringing together a consortium of seven Latin American and European universities. I also co-developed the implementation strategy, balancing its adjustment to university structures while also enabling cross-university thematic areas and courses. Some of my responsibilities included the periodical reporting of progress to the funding body, the European Union ALFA III Program and supporting cooperation with the Water Justice Network.
Research Assistant At Centrum (Business Center)
I surveyed the literature on consumer behavior toward green certification and informed a framework to run a prospective study in Peru and Spain.
